Notice Title

London APMS GP Contracts (T5)

Notice Description

NHS England London Region (hereafter referred to as "The Authority") invites Expressions of Interest (EoIs) and completed Invitation to Tender (ITT) submissions from all suitable providers of primary care services, who are capable of undertaking GP APMS contracts in London, as part of Tranche 5 (T5) of the London APMS Programme. 16 (sixteen) APMS contracts are offered in different parts of London, Potential providers are invited to express an interest in one or more of these opportunities. Bedfont Practice (TW14) The Great West Surgery/Heston Practice (TW4) Isleworth Medical Centre (formerly Isleworth Practice/Grove Medical Centre) (TW7) Orient Community Practice (E10) The Rowans Surgery (SW16) Somers Town Medical Centre (NW1) St Ann's Road Surgery (formerly Chestnuts Park Surgery/The Laurels Medical Practice) (N15) Park Royal Medical Practice (formerly Acton Lane/Harness Harlesden) (NW10) Edridge Road Health Centre (CR9) Featherstone Road Health Centre (UB2) Halfpenny Steps Health Centre (W10) Sandringham Practice (E8) Springfield Tollgate Practice (formerly Springfield Health Centre/Tollgate Lodge Health Centre) (N16) Kings Park Surgery (RM3) Woodbridge Medical Centre (UB1) Broadmead Surgery (UB5) The Procurement process will be facilitated entirely online via The Authority's e-procurement portal (ProContract). Interested Applicants wishing to participate in the procurement must register, express an interest, and complete the online questionnaires hosted on the portal prior to the deadline for submission (17th February 2017). All clarification requests and correspondence pertaining to this ITT opportunity must be directed through the portal. Contracts will be awarded for an initial period of 5 years, with optional extension for a further 5 years. i.e. Maximum total duration for each contract is 10 years in total. A timetable for the procurement, guidance re: process, and supplementary information relating to each contract opportunity is also available from the Portal. This Tender process is being managed by North East London Commissioning Support Unit (NEL CSU) on behalf of The Authority in connection with a competitive procurement exercise that is being conducted in accordance with a process based on the Open Procedure under the Public Contract Regulations 2015 ("the Regulations" (as amended)). The services to which this Procurement relates fall within the "Light Touch Regime" (LTR) governing procurement of Health, Social, Education and Other service contracts. Neither the reference to "Open Procedure", "ITT", "PQQ / SQ", the use of the term "Tender process", nor any other indication shall be taken to mean that the Contracting Authority intends to hold itself bound to any of the Regulations, save those applicable to LTR provisions.
